Ovarian cancer symptoms not apparent until later stages
• It is the eighth most common cancer in women
• Lifestyle changes can help reduce risk
New Delhi, 18 September, 2017: Of all cancers in women, ovarian cancer is the eighth most common cancer and ranks fifth in terms of mortality, according to statistics. About two-thirds of those with this condition stand at an advanced stage of the disease during diagnosis and less than 50% survive longer than five years after being diagnosed. As per the IMA, the primary reason for reaching the advanced stage and eventual death is that in many women with this disease, there are no symptoms.
Ovarian cancer refers to any cancerous growth in the ovary. A majority of ovarian cancers arise from the epithelium (outer lining) of the ovary. The most common ovarian cancers are called epithelial ovarian cancers (EOC) and other types include ovarian low malignant potential tumor (OLMPT), germ cell tumors, and sex cord-stromal tumors.
Speaking about this, Padma Shri Awardee Dr K K Aggarwal, National President Indian Medical Association (IMA) and President Heart Care Foundation of India (HCFI) and Dr RN Tandon – Honorary Secretary General IMA in a joint statement, said, "Ovarian cancer often goes undetected until it spreads within the pelvis and stomach. In such an advanced stage, it may not be possible to treat the condition making it life threatening. Often, this condition has no symptoms in the early stages and even at a later stage; there are non-specific symptoms such as loss of appetite and weight loss. Mutations in BRCA1 and BRCA2 are responsible for most inherited ovarian cancers. When these genes are normal, they help prevent cancer by making proteins that keep cells from growing abnormally. However, inheriting a mutation in one of these genes from either parent, makes this cancer preventing protein less effective. This increases the chances of developing ovarian cancer.”
Some possible early symptoms of ovarian cancer include pain in the pelvis, lower side of the body, lower stomach, and back; indigestion or heartburn; feeling full rapidly when eating; more frequent urination; pain during intercourse; and changes in bowel habits. As it progresses, symptoms such as nausea, weight loss, breathlessness, tiredness, and loss of appetite can also appear.
Adding further, Dr Aggarwal, said, “The treatment for this condition consists of surgery, chemotherapy, a combination of surgery with chemotherapy, and at times, radiotherapy as well. The mode is decided depending on factors such as type of ovarian cancer, its stage and grade, and the patient’s general health. Contraceptive pills can help reduce the risk of ovarian cancer in women and also protect them from the disease even 30 years after they stop taking the drugs.”
Some other tips that can help prevent the risk of ovarian cancer in women include the following.
Breastfeeding The longer a woman breastfeeds, the lower her risk of ovarian and fallopian tube cancer.
Pregnancy The more full-term pregnancies a woman has had, the lower her risk of ovarian and fallopian tube cancer.
Surgical procedures Women who have had a hysterectomy or a tubal ligation may have a lower risk of developing ovarian cancer.
Adopting a healthier lifestyle This entails consuming more fruits and vegetables, exercising regularly, and avoiding smoking and drinking.

Natural diet efficient in reducing cancer risk
Natural diet efficient in reducing cancer risk
Adding just one serving of fruit or vegetables per 1000 calories consumed can result in a 6% reduction of risk of cancer
New Delhi, Friday February 17 2017
As per a recent study, the consumption of fresh vegetables and fruits help lower your chances of getting head, neck, breast, ovarian and pancreatic cancers. Even one additional serving of vegetables or fruits could help lower the risk of head and neck cancer. The more fruits and vegetables you can consume, the better.
In another study, broccoli and soy protein were found to protect against the more aggressive breast and ovarian cancers. When consumed together, digesting broccoli and soy forms a compound called di-indolylmethane (DIM). In lab experiments, the researchers found that DIM could affect the motility of breast and ovarian cancer cells, which could help keep cancers from spreading. Soy, acts like estrogen and is a nutritious, healthy food, and should be eaten in moderation.
Padma Shri Awardee Dr. K.K Aggarwal, National President Indian Medical Association (IMA) and President Heart Care Foundation of India (HCFI) and Dr RN Tandon – Honorary Secretary General IMA in a joint statement said that, “Those who eat six servings of fruits and vegetables per 1,000 calories have a 29% decreased risk relative to those who have 1.5 servings. In the study, after adjusting the data to account for smoking and alcohol use – known head and neck cancer risk factors – the researchers found that those who consumed the most fruits and vegetables had the lowest risk for head and neck cancers. Vegetables appeared to offer more cancer prevention than fruits alone did.”
“Diets high in animal fat and low in fibre are associated with metabolic syndrome -- a collection of conditions including abdominal obesity, elevated blood sugar and high blood pressure. A high fat diet contributes to nourish cancer cells, thus accelerating the disease’s progression. Vegetable based diet also contains several protective compounds like flavonols which are found in fruits and vegetables, such as onions, apples, berries, kale and broccoli. Evidence suggests that people who had the highest consumption of flavonols reduced their risk of pancreatic cancer by 23%. The benefit is even greater for people who smoke”, added Dr. K.K Aggarwal.
Following are some healthy diet tips:
1. Eat multiple servings of brightly colored and seasonal fruits and vegetables every day. Fill half your plate with fruit and vegetables.
2. Choose healthy fats. Use fat–free or low fat milk and/or dairy products.
3. Severely limit red meat, including beef, pork, lamb, and goat, and processed meat consumption.
4. Opt for healthier sources of protein like fish, skinless poultry, beans, and eggs.
5. Avoid partially hydrogenated fats (trans fats), present in many fast foods and packaged foods.
6. Cut down dramatically on salt.
7. At least half of your grains should be whole grains.
8. Regular exercise pares down your risk of developing some deadly problems, including heart disease, stroke, and certain types of cancer.

Today is World Head & Neck Cancer Day
Today is World Head & Neck Cancer Day
Dear Colleague
We are all aware that Head-Neck Cancer is among the most common cancers in the Indian subcontinent.
Head and Neck Squamous Cell Carcinoma (HNSCC) with a global incidence of over 500,000 cases and 200,000 deaths annually is the leading cause of mortality and disability in many parts of the world. In India also it accounts for nearly 1.5 lakh cases every year. It mainly affects people in the productive age group, yet most of this mortality and morbidity is preventable. The burden of HNSCC is putting a strain on our national health care systems and impoverishing individuals, families and society.
The International Federation of Head & Neck Oncologic Societies (IFHNOS) has declared to observe 27th July as "World Head & Neck Cancer Day (WHNCD)" to draw the world’s attention on effective care and control of HNSCC, for all to work together and also to reduce use of Tobacco- the most prevalent but preventable cause of Head & Neck Cancer. The move is supported by many Head Neck Societies around the globe, numerous Governments, UICC and civil society organizations.
IFHNOS is a global organization established through cooperation of national and regional Societies and Organizations in the Specialty of Head and Neck Surgery and Oncology with membership from national and regional multidisciplinary organizations, representing 65 countries. The purpose of the Federation is to provide a common platform for Specialists in the field of Head and Neck Cancer to interact in professional matters of mutual interest.
IFHNOS declared 27th July as World Head & Neck Cancer Day on the occasion of its 5th World Congress in New York on 27th July 2014, the largest gathering of Head and Neck Cancer specialists in history.
Oral Cancers are often associated with smoking and alcohol use, however, oropharyngeal cancers (cancer of back or base of tongue and tonsils are associated with human papilloma virus and marijuana use as well as smoking and alcohol use.
WHNCD targets two areas:
• Advocacy for strengthening health care system and introduce community-based approaches for awareness, risks, prevention and early detection of HNSCC.
• Enhance expertise of physicians by upgrading their knowledge and skills through CME programs. WHNCD activities can be :-
o Educating the physicians on early diagnosis, current treatment paradigms and frontiers in research in Head and Neck Cancer
o Awareness programs for the general public.
o Free screening for Head and Neck cancers.
o Interaction with cancer survivors and their families.
o Interaction with government and policy makers.
Involvement of newspaper and electronic media, other NGOs and Government representatives in the programs will give wide publicity and spread awareness too.
IMA supports this International movement to increase awareness, promote education & training in early diagnosis and treatment of this imminently preventable cancer.

Strong evidence that alcohol causes cancer at seven sites in the body
Strong evidence that alcohol causes cancer at seven sites in the body
Dr K K Aggarwal There is strong epidemiological evidence that alcohol causes cancer at seven sites in the body and probably others, says a new study in the latest issue of the journal Addiction reported 21st July, 2016. These sites include oropharynx, larynx, esophagus, liver, colon, rectum and female breast. A "dose-response relationship" between alcohol and cancer was observed for all these cancers, where the increase in cancer risk with increased average consumption is monotonic, either linear or exponential, without evidence of threshold of effect. The beverage type did not appear to influence any variation. The strength of the association with alcohol varies by site of the cancer, being particularly strong for mouth, pharynx and esophagus (relative risk in the range of 4–7 for ≥ 50 g of alcohol per day compared with no drinking) and less so for colorectal cancer, liver and breast cancer (relative risk approximately 1.5 for ≥ 50 g/day). Alcohol-attributable cancers at these sites were estimated to make up 5.8% of all cancer deaths globally. These conclusions are based on comprehensive reviews undertaken in the last decade by the World Cancer Research Fund and American Institute for Cancer Research, the International Agency for Research on Cancer, the Global Burden of Disease Alcohol Group including a comprehensive dose–response meta-analysis published last year in the British Journal of cancer. In the study, Jennie Connor, Dept. of Preventive and Social Medicine, University of Otago, New Zealand from New Zealand attempted to clarify the strength of the evidence for alcohol as a cause of cancer, and the meaning of cause in this context. Even without complete knowledge of biological mechanisms, the authors observed, the epidemiological evidence can support the judgment that alcohol causes cancer of these seven sites.
